Relief extended to flood-hit families in Anato village
DIMAPUR — The Niuland district administration handed over immediate relief assistance to eight flood-affected families from Anato village under Kuhuboto sub-division on September 15. The relief was distributed by Sub-Divisional Officer (Civil) of Kuhuboto Nuhuta Tunyi in the presence of the district project associate of the District Disaster Management Authority, Niuland. According to a DIPR report, the assistance was provided as part of the administration’s ongoing efforts to extend immediate support to families affected by recent flooding in the area.
Education Conclave 2026 to be held in Chümoukedima
KOHIMA — The Education Conclave 2026, focusing on the implementation of the National Education Policy (NEP) 2020 in the northeastern states, will be held on September 18 and 19 at JP Park and Banquets, Naga United village, Chümoukedima. According to the organisers, the two-day conclave will bring together education representatives from across the northeastern states for presentations and panel discussions on the progress, challenges, and opportunities in implementing the policy. The inaugural session on September 18 will be attended by Minister for Higher Education and Tourism Temjen Imna Along as chief host.
Internal Security Scheme meeting convened in Wokha
DIMAPUR — A meeting on the Internal Security Scheme was convened at the Deputy Commissioner’s conference hall in Wokha under the chairmanship of Deputy Commissioner K Mhathung Tsanglao on Wednesday. The deputy commissioner briefed the members on the objectives and necessity of the scheme, stressing its importance for safeguarding the district against any eventuality. The meeting discussed overall preparedness measures, with a focus on strengthening coordination among departments and ensuring readiness to respond effectively to potential challenges in Wokha district.
Legal awareness programme in Chozuba
DIMAPUR — An awareness and sensitisation programme on legal rights and protection for women and children under the aegis of the Ministry of Women and Child Development will be held at Vamuzo Memorial Town Hall in Chozuba on September 18 at 11 am. According to a DIPR report, the programme will be organised by the district administration of Phek under Mission Shakti in collaboration with the District Legal Services Authority (DLSA), Phek. Additional Deputy Commissioner Zapuno Khatso will deliver the keynote address, while District Mission Coordinator of DHEW Vileno K Thisa will highlight schemes and programme components for women under Mission Shakti.
